Premier League giants Manchester United, Arsenal, and Chelsea are reportedly considering a move for Newcastle United striker Callum Wilson. The 28-year-old has been in fine form this season, scoring seven goals in 14 appearances.

According to The Standard, Newcastle are open to selling Wilson in order to comply with Premier League financial regulations. The £18 million price tag has caught the attention of the three clubs, who are all looking to bolster their attacking options.

Wilson’s experience and goal-scoring ability make him an attractive short-term solution for United, Arsenal, and Chelsea. The striker has previously been linked with a move to Atletico Madrid and AC Milan, but his desire to secure a place in the England squad for Euro 2024 has kept him in the Premier League.

Arsenal are reportedly interested in signing Napoli striker Victor Osimhen this summer. The Nigerian international has already made up his mind about his next career move and is attracting attention from several Premier League clubs.

Osimhen recently signed a new contract with Napoli, but the inclusion of a £112 million release clause means the Italian club may have to sell if that figure is met. According to Fabrizio Romano, Arsenal is one of the clubs to keep an eye on in the race for Osimhen’s signature.

While Arsenal has been linked with other forwards during the January transfer window, it seems they will wait until the summer to make their move. Osimhen’s impressive performances in Naples have caught the attention of clubs across Europe, and it remains to be seen where he will end up.
